Proud to say that I'm a regular here and so so glad to support this business and community. A homey, family run diner, this is the best place for weekend breakfasts. I always get the breakfast burritos (5/5), and they hit the spot every time. Great size, I usually get mine with cheddar and bacon, ask for the red potatoes with onions and bell peppers (5/5) on the outside. The salsa is amazing, adds that perfect mild flavor on the burrito without being too spicy. I could eat the potatoes all day. There's an option to have them inside the burrito, but I like them better as a side. When you walk in, you order at the counter and given a number, food is always out quickly and timely, in 10-15 min. Staff is always warm, friendly, and attentive to your needs. A cornerstone restaurant in the community, I'll continue to support Dino's.

Dino's has long been a Fremont institute as a family diner and one of the OG brunch places in the area. Known for delivering an authentic family diner experience and serving hearty food, it's been no wonder why they've been around for so long. Unfortunately, they will be shutting down on December 31st, so I had to give it one last go before they did. Let's take one last trip down memory lane.EDIT: Looks like they are no longer closing! Great news!FOODDino's delivers the traditional diner experience which means large portions of delicious food to keep you happy. They used to offer dinner, but they rolled it back a few years ago, so this is more of a breakfast and lunch place now.We ordered a lot of food: the Monte Cristo sandwich, a breakfast burrito, a breakfast plate, and a side of pancakes. Each of the entrees came with a side of potatoes, and we always got hash browns.The Monte Cristo is one of their most popular dishes here. It's packed with a bunch of meat inside some French toast. They also have maple syrup on the side if you want to add some additional sweetness to the sandwich. The Monte Cristo was great; if you are in the mood for a breakfast sandwich, this is what you are looking for.The breakfast burrito was huge. I think the tortilla could've been toasted longer, but that's a personal preference. Lots of food inside here and there's a side of jalapenos if you want a stronger kick to it.Breakfast plate and the pancakes are what you expect for a diner. Delicious and big portions, nothing to complain about. The hash browns that they serve here are also delicious.SERVICEThey used to be a sit down restaurant, but now you order at the counter. The server will give you a number and then you find an open table and sit down. The servers will then bring your food when it is ready. When you are done, you pay at the cashier.They don't have menus at the counter, so check the menu by the entrance before you order. No issues with the service.COSTPrices are reasonable and are about what you expect for a diner. The portions are large enough that you can box it to go and have it for a snack or another meal later in the day. I paid about $60 for all this food for 4 people, so it's a pretty good deal.SETTINGLots of people here for the last week, so I recommend arriving early if you can or later in the day. Interior looks like a standard traditional diner; there's an area closer to the street that you can sit down on and looks out at the street. This place is great for a casual brunch or just hanging out with friends. Clientele here are usually younger folks or older folks.Parking lot is bigger than it seems from the street, so you shouldn't have any issue for parking.Overall, I'm sad to see this Fremont business close down; I'm sure anyone who has been in Fremont has driven by Dino's many times. Make sure to stop by for one last visit; it's exactly what you expect out of a traditional family diner.If you miss Dino's, I highly recommend checking out Skilletz for breakfast/lunch and Billy Roy's for dinner since they are run by the same owner. Hopefully, something worthy takes up this restaurant; I'll keep my eyes peeled. (Rumor has it the owner is going to open a brand new business here).4/5
